Business analytics courses can help you learn data visualization, statistical analysis, predictive modeling, and decision-making frameworks. You can build skills in interpreting complex datasets, identifying trends, and communicating insights effectively. Many courses introduce tools like Excel, Tableau, and Python, that support analyzing data and creating impactful visual reports. You'll also explore key topics such as data mining, performance metrics, and customer segmentation, all of which are vital for driving informed business strategies.
